Job description

Overview:
Relevant Experience: 10+ Years
Seeking a highly skilled and experienced Senior iOS Engineer to review, assess performance bottlenecks, and drive improvements across our iOS applications. This role requires deep expertise in Swift, iOS frameworks, and software architecture, along with a passion for clean, maintainable, and scalable code. And he/she has to lead a team a well.
Key Responsibilities:
  • Evaluate and improve existing architecture for scalability, modularity, and testability.
  • Analyze app performance using tools like Instruments, Xcode Profiler, and third-party monitoring solutions.
  • Identify and resolve memory leaks, CPU usage spikes, and UI rendering issues.
  • Optimize networking, database access, and background processing for speed and efficiency.
  • Conduct thorough code reviews to ensure adherence to best practices, coding standards, and architectural guidelines.
  • Identify areas of technical debt and propose actionable refactoring strategies.
  • Document code review findings, performance benchmarks, and improvement plans.

Qualifications:
  • 10+ years of professional iOS development experience.
  • Expert-level proficiency in Swift and familiarity with Objective-C.
  • Strong understanding of iOS SDK, UIKit, SwiftUI, Core Data, and RESTful APIs.
  • Experience with performance profiling and debugging tools.
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ills.

Q: What skills or qualities help someone succeed as a Senior iOS Developer?

A: To succeed as a Senior iOS Developer, key technical skills include expertise in Swift programming language, proficiency in Xcode and other Apple development tools, and a strong understanding of iOS architecture, design patterns, and mobile app security. Additionally, soft skills such as effective communication, leadership, and problem-solving abilities are crucial for guiding junior developers, collaborating with cross-functional teams, and driving project delivery. By combining these technical and soft skills, Senior iOS Developers can drive innovation, improve code quality, and contribute to the growth and success of their organization.

Q: What is the career path for a Senior iOS Developer?

A: A Senior iOS Developer typically progresses through a career path that starts with an entry-level iOS Developer role, followed by mid-level positions such as iOS Engineer or Lead iOS Developer, and eventually reaches the senior role, overseeing the development of complex iOS applications and leading teams of developers. Key opportunities for skill development and growth in this role include mastering advanced iOS technologies, learning cloud-based services, and developing leadership and project management skills, which can be achieved through online courses, conferences, and mentorship programs. Long-term career prospects for Senior iOS Developers may include transitioning into technical leadership roles, such as Technical Lead or Engineering Manager, or pursuing specialized roles like Architect or Product Manager, or even starting their own mobile app development company.
